如何使用ADB在开发人员选项中保持清醒状态?

时间:2013-08-16 09:10:36

标签: android adb

我正在尝试找到一种方法来启用开发人员选项 - >通过亚行保持清醒选项。 我找到的解决方案是找到一种方法来打开开发人员选项菜单,然后在ADB中使用setevent命令启用保持唤醒选项。

现在我正在尝试找到将打开开发人员选项的命令。 我找到了打开显示选项的命令:

adb shell am start -n com.android.settings/.DisplaySettings

所以我认为存在打开开发人员选项的类似命令。

如果有的话,我也很高兴听到另一种通过ADB启用保持清醒选项的方法。

6 个答案:

答案 0 :(得分:42)

adb shell am start -n com.android.settings/.DevelopmentSettings

答案 1 :(得分:11)

您可以启用保持清醒选项,而无需使用以下命令的用户界面:

adb shell settings put global stay_on_while_plugged_in 3

答案 2 :(得分:5)

好的,我找到了办法:

adb shell am start -S com.android.settings/.Settings\$DevelopmentSettingsActivity

我用过这个:https://github.com/android/platform_packages_apps_settings/blob/master/AndroidManifest.xml

找到我需要的活动的名称。

现在我必须弄清楚如何通过创建触摸事件来选择保持清醒选项......

答案 3 :(得分:0)

好吧,我知道这不是MiSo的要求,但我认为这可能是相关的,我创建了一个应用程序,该应用程序将在您连接/断开ADB时启用/禁用此“保持唤醒”设置。

该代码可在以下位置开源:ABD-Stay_Awake

答案 4 :(得分:0)

设置“插入时保持清醒”设置。

adb shell svc power stayon true  

答案 5 :(得分:-3)

试试这个:

setprop persist.sys.usb.config mtp,adb
相关问题